How do you store a cutting board on the wall?
If you do not mind messing with your shelves/cabinets, you can get creative with storing your cutting boards. The first option is to use a towel hanger. Instead of installing it on a wall, opt to place it under a shelf. You will have to use two towel hangers to give the boards enough support.
How do you store a vertical cutting board?
If You Want to Hide Them Turn a lower cabinet into a pull-out drawer (Rev-a-Shelf makes a ton of genius solutions for this). Adding slots will allow you to stack things vertically so you barely have to bend over. If you don’t mind crouching down, simply build dividers into a cabinet.

Why do chopping boards have to be stored in vertical position?
iv) Store chopping boards in a vertical or upright position. This helps to prevent trapping of moisture and the accumulation of dust or grime under the boards. Proper storage of chopping boards helps to keep them clean and dry.

Can I use polyurethane on a cutting board?
Polyurethane is a fine choice to use on a counter, as long as you don’t use the counter as a cutting board. If you do cut directly on the polyurethane surface it will be damaged.
How often should you oil a cutting board?
We recommended you oil your cutting board every month or when dry to the touch. Board cream should be applied at the same time as oiling.
